Wood cladding repair services involve addressing issues related to the exterior wooden panels that cover the walls of a property. Over time, wood cladding can suffer from damage caused by weather exposure, moisture infiltration, pests, or general wear and tear. Repairing these panels typically includes replacing rotten or warped sections, filling cracks, and resealing surfaces to restore the cladding’s structural integrity and appearance. Skilled professionals assess the extent of damage and perform targeted repairs to ensure the cladding functions effectively and maintains the property's aesthetic appeal.
These services help resolve common problems such as wood rot, warping, peeling paint, and moisture intrusion.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to further deterioration, reducing the insulation value of the cladding and potentially causing damage to the underlying structure. Repairing damaged wood panels not only improves the visual appearance of a property but also helps prevent more costly repairs in the future by maintaining the integrity of the exterior envelope. Properly repaired cladding can also enhance the property’s resistance to weather elements and pests.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for wood cladding repair services range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age and material used. Minor repairs, such as replacing individual boards, t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um. Larger projects involving extensive damage can significantly increase the cost.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for wood cladding repair varies, with replacement boards costing between $10 and $30 per square foot. Premium wood types or custom finishes may raise material costs further.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for wood cladding repair services generally range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on project size, complexity, and the number of workers required. More intricate repairs or higher elevations may incur additional charges.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as surface prep, paint or stain, and protective treatments can add $200 to $1,000 to the overall cost. What types of damage can wood cladding repair address? Repair services can fix issues such as rot, warping, cracking, and water damage to restore the appearance and integrity of wood cladding.
How do professionals typically repair damaged wood cladding? They may replace severely damaged panels, sand and refinish surfaces, or apply sealants to prevent further deterioration.
Is it possible to prevent future damage after repair? Yes, contractors often recommend treatments like sealing, staining, or weatherproofing to help protect wood cladding from future issues.
What signs indicate that wood cladding needs repair? Visible warping, cracking, discoloration, or signs of moisture intrusion are common indicators that repair is needed.
